Herbage Having a Reflective Coating
20230000132 · 2023-01-05 ·

Herbage such as trimmed Cannabis flowers have a reflective coating that sparkles and improves shelf life. The invention includes a first coating of a first Cannabis plant extract including at least 60%-98% Tetrahydrocannabinol (THC) that forms a hardened layer on the dried herbage to mechanically preserve the shape of the herbage and enables handling and grinding of the herbage. A second coating of a second Cannabis plant extract, including at least 90-99% Tetrahydrocannabinolic acid (THCa) forms crystals, or “diamonds”, that are embedded in the first coating to improve aesthetics by reflecting light. The crystals improve shelf life by reducing absorption of light by the herbage. The weight sum of the combined coatings are in a particular ratio to the herbage. This ratio is between 1:4 and 2:1 on a weight to weight basis to cause the herbage to sparkle, to improve shelf life, and to enable grinding without sticking.

Thermally Conductive Tobacco Composition, Method for Providing the Tobacco Composition, and Use
20220400736 · 2022-12-22 ·

A heat-conducting tobacco composition comprising at least one sort of tobacco in at least one confectioning of the tobacco for smoking tobacco consumption. The heat-conducting tobacco composition is configured or designed as a tobacco article for at least one smoking article selected from the following group: dry tobacco article for cigarettes, cigarillos, cigars, semi-dry tobacco article for smoking tobacco pipes, moist tobacco article for water pipes; wherein the heat-conducting tobacco composition further comprises at least one metallic, in particular noble metallic component which performs a physical heat-conducting function during smoking, in particular when exposed to heat by ember/glow or by heating elements of the smoking article, and which is chemically inert at least in the temperature range required for smoking, and which is admixed to the tobacco and distributed in the tobacco composition in such a way that the heat distribution within the tobacco composition is homogenized during smoking.

Process For Incorporating Additives Into Aerosol-Producing Substrates and Products Made Therefrom
20220369693 · 2022-11-24 ·

A process is disclosed for incorporating additives into aerosol-producing substrates. During the process, an additive is incorporated into an infusing liquid. An aerosol-producing filler is submerged in the infusing liquid and the resulting mixture is subjected to reduced pressures that cause the infusing liquid to infuse into the material. The material is dried leaving behind the additive in a controlled amount and uniformly dispersed throughout the material. In one application, cannabidiol is incorporated into a tobacco filler or a hemp filler.

Composite tobacco-containing materials

Tobacco products suitable for oral ingestion are provided. The tobacco products include a tobacco composition and at least one edible film. The edible film can include one or more of (i) a fruit or vegetable puree and (ii) a denatured protein. A multi-layer tobacco product is provided that includes a tobacco composition in the form of a compressed sheet layer and at least one edible film adjacent to the tobacco composition layer, wherein the edible film includes a puree of at least one fruit, vegetable, or a combination thereof. A process for preparing a tobacco product is also provided, such as a process that includes receiving a tobacco composition and an edible film; applying the edible film to the tobacco composition; and compressing the edible film and tobacco composition together to form a multi-layer tobacco product.

ABNORMALLY-SHAPED TOBACCO GRANULES AND PREPARATION METHOD THEREOF, TOBACCO PRODUCT AND PREPARATION METHOD THEREOF

Abnormally-shaped tobacco granules are provided. The tobacco granules comprise a tobacco granule body and a coating attached to the surface of the tobacco granule body. The coating contains an adhesive. The surface of the abnormally-shaped tobacco granule has one or more grooves and/or ridges, and/or, the abnormally-shaped tobacco granule has through holes therein. The surface grooves of the abnormally-shaped tobacco granules can serve as smoke channels after the tobacco granules are bonded, cured and shaped, so that the air permeability inside a total-granule tobacco product is greatly improved. The smoking resistance of cigarettes is reduced. The flammability of cigarettes is improved and the consumption of tobacco raw materials is reduced. A preparation method of the abnormally-shaped tobacco granules, a tobacco product comprising the abnormally-shaped tobacco granules, and a preparation method thereof are also provided.
